Choir students will usher in warmer days with their Spring Concert May 19 at 7:30 p.m. in the auditorium.
The concert will feature a wide variety of musical styles.
“We are performing one of our songs, a spiritual piece, from our competition show,” sophomore Samuel Duling said. “We are also doing a Spanish choral piece that is a lot of fun. Plus, another one of composer Eric Whitacre’s songs like Cloudburst from our fall show.”
Not only does the concert promise a wide variety of genres, but also talented vocals.
“All of our choirs are really good this year,” choir director Kevin Manley said. “Overall this is one of the best groups we’ve had in the last couple of years. They’re very talented.”
